Description
Daly River Nauiyu Community, located 224 km south of Darwin, is a small community (approximately 450, mostly Aboriginal people) nestled alongside the elegant and abundant Daly River, Northern Territory, Australia. The traditional owners of the land are the Malak Malak people and the main language spoken is Ngungi Kurunggurr (http://www.darwin.catholic.org.au/aboriginal-communities/sub-nauiyu.htm). This project explores the school as a complex living system. It applies the ideas of learning power as prototyping interventions for community, leadership, teachers and students.
